5 silver dollars fullgrown
cory full grown
common pleco 4"
2 firemouths 2 1/2"
4 Severum 4"
2 Blue Acara 3"
1 blood parrot 1" (has to stay)
1 sun cat full grown (has to stay)
1 kissing Gourami 3"

what combo should go for me not to be overstocked in my72 gal bow?

The only ones that really need to go are the Kissing Gouramis and the Common Pleco, because they both get at least a foot long and need a 120 gallon tank or larger. Also, the severums also grow pretty large (about 8-10"), so you might have problems with those later.

When your severum, acaras and firemouths start breeding your tank is going to become more aggressive. Personally I would get rid of the gourami, severum and acaras, replace the common pleco with a BN, get a couple more firemouth and also increase the cories. Without the Severum and acaras I think your cories will be safer.
